Criteria for Rating Bicycle Shops
When evaluating bicycle shops, various criteria come into play. These can determine the overall quality of service, product availability, and customer satisfaction. Here are some factors that influence how we rate the bicycle shops in Everett:
- Quality of Service: Are the staff friendly, knowledgeable, and able to address customer questions? The best bicycle shops provide a welcoming environment.
- Product Variety: A wide selection of bicycles, parts, and accessories is essential in finding the right fit for each cyclist's needs.
- Repair Services: Efficient and reliable repair services can be a game-changer for many riders. Shops that offer comprehensive maintenance options usually stand out.
- Community Engagement: Bicycle shops that participate in or host community rides, workshops, or events contribute positively to the local culture.
- Overall Reputation: Customer reviews, testimonials, and word-of-mouth can significantly affect a shop's standing in the community.

Tim's Bicycle Shop: A Local Favorite
Located in the heart of Everett, Tim's Bicycle Shop is revered for its friendly service and expert staff. This shop has built a loyal customer base over the years, thanks to its commitment to addressing customers' needs with a personal touch. Tim's shop specializes in a wide range of bicycles, from road bikes to mountain bikes, and offers various accessories and gear to enhance your riding experience.
What sets Tim's apart from other shops is its strong connection with the Everett community. The staff at Tim's is known for engaging with customers, offering advice tailored to individual riding styles and preferences. Many regulars swear by their exceptional repair services, ensuring that bikes are maintained to the highest standards. If you're in search of a welcoming atmosphere and reliable service, Tim's Bicycle Shop should be your first stop in Everett.
Bicycle Centers: Knowledgeable Staff at Your Service
Bicycle Centers in Everett stands out for its knowledgeable staff who possess an extensive understanding of biking needs. This shop is perfect for customers seeking expert advice on selecting the right bicycle or the latest accessories. While sometimes perceived as less personable, the technical expertise available here is invaluable, especially for serious cyclists.
Bicycle Centers offer a variety of bicycles, including road, hybrid, and electric models. Their repair services are equally impressive, employing skilled technicians who can handle routine maintenance and complex repairs. Whether you’re a seasoned cyclist or a newcomer, the staff at Bicycle Centers can provide assistance to ensure every purchase fits perfectly with your biking lifestyle.
Spokemotion: A Family-Run Treasure in Monroe
Although not located directly in Everett, Spokemotion in nearby Monroe is a family-run shop that many Everett residents frequent. The shop prides itself on its family-friendly atmosphere and commitment to customer satisfaction, making it a favorite among local cyclists. The staff is known for their approachable demeanor and extensive knowledge of various bicycle brands and models.
Spokemotion specializes in high-quality bikes and accessories alongside services like repairs and custom builds. Despite the distance from Everett, many cycling enthusiasts regularly make the trip due to the exceptional level of service and community engagement that Spokemotion offers.
Importance of Specialized Services for Vintage Bikes
For cyclists who cherish classic models, specialized services for vintage bikes can significantly enhance the ownership experience. Shops like Tim’s and Bicycle Centers often have the tools and expertise necessary to repair, restore, or maintain these beloved bicycles.
Specialized care is crucial for pre-mid-90s models due to their unique components and materials. Not all shops possess the required skills or parts to service these vintage bicycles. Consequently, seeking shops with a solid reputation for working on older models can lead to a better bike maintenance experience and prolong the life of your cherished vintage bike.
Online Retailers: Supporting Classic Bicycle Maintenance
In the era of digital shopping, many cyclists turn to online retailers to find specific parts and accessories necessary for maintaining their older bikes. While local bicycle shops provide essential services and support, online platforms often carry an extensive range of vintage bike components that might be unavailable in-store.
For cyclists who frequently work on their pre-mid-90s steel-framed road bikes, sourcing rare parts online can be a lifesaver. Websites dedicated to vintage bike components help enthusiasts maintain and restore their bicycles, ensuring they remain rideable for years to come.
